Navigo Pass Mastery
Buy weekly zones 1-5 pass at stations for all Metro, RER, buses including Versailles; load via app.
Picnic Pro Tip
Assemble from markets (cheese, baguette, wine); ideal for parks like Luxembourg or Champ de Mars evenings.
Metro Etiquette
Let passengers exit first, stand right on escalators, avoid eye contact but smiles ok.
Reservation Ritual
Book dinners 1-2 days ahead via phone or app; say 'Bonjour' first.
Water Fountain Hack
Drink from green Wallace fountains (eau potable); carry reusable bottle.
Sunset Strategy
Sacré-Cœur or Arc de Triomphe for best free golden-hour views.
Laundry Local
Use laundromats (laveries) with café next door; 20-min cycles.
A la Carte Ordering
Menus offer value sets; share appetizers to sample more.
